Fisetin is a flavonoid (found in strawberries) that gained attention as a 'senolytic': a compound that helps clear senescent 'zombie' cells thought to drive ageing.

In mice, intermittent high-dose fisetin cleared senescent cells and extended healthspan, which is genuinely striking. But human evidence is almost absent; clinical trials are only now underway, so buying it for anti-ageing is acting well ahead of the data. Bioavailability is also poor.
